CSS中的expresssion的使用及注意事项

网站建设 2025-06-07 11:49www.dzhlxh.cn网站建设

Expression在CSS中的独特作用与用法

在网页开发中,Expression犹如一把双刃剑,它在某些情境下能够帮助开发者解决特定问题,但同时也带有一些不容忽视的弊端。今天,我们来深入了解一下它的作用与用法。

一、Expression的独特作用

在JavaScript与CSS的交融中,Expression起到了一种桥梁的作用。它允许我们将JavaScript脚本嵌入到CSS文件中,为开发者提供了一种在CSS中动态调整样式属性的手段。

二、用法实例

以一段针对IE6浏览器的代码为例:

```css

div {

_width: expression((document.documentElement.clientWidth || document.body.clientWidth) < 960 ? "960px" : "");

}

```

这段样式的作用是使IE6中的div元素在宽度小于960像素时,其宽度自动调整为960像素。这种动态调整的特性在某些情况下是非常有用的。

三、浏览器的兼容性

需要注意的是,Expression主要适用于IE浏览器,对于其他现代浏览器来说,可能无法识别和支持这种写法。在使用Expression时,我们必须考虑到浏览器的兼容性。

四、Expression的潜在问题

虽然Expression在某些情况下很有用,但开发者通常建议尽量避免使用它。原因在于,Expression的计算频率非常高,不仅会在页面显示和缩放时重新计算,甚至在页面滚动、鼠标移动时都会触发重新计算,这无疑会对页面性能产生影响。

五、学习与

想要更深入地了解Expression及其相关知识的朋友们,可以通过搜索相关文档和教程来进一步学习。对于是否使用Expression,开发者应当慎重考虑其优缺点,根据实际需求做出最佳选择。在大多数情况下,为了保持页面的流畅性和性能,我们更倾向于使用其他更现代、更高效的CSS技术。

提醒各位开发者朋友,在编写代码时,尽量避免使用已经被淘汰或者存在明显缺陷的技术,如Expression。随着Web技术的不断进步,我们有更多的工具和手段可以选择,让我们共同并拥抱更美好的未来。

上一篇:CAD2015多重引线标注的用法讲解 下一篇:没有了

Copyright © 2016-2025 www.dzhlxh.cn 金源码 版权所有 Power by

网站模板下载|网络推广|微博营销|seo优化|视频营销|网络营销|微信营销|网站建设|织梦模板|小程序模板